Understanding PIP5K:
PIP5K is an enzyme involved in the synthesis of phosphatidylinositol 4,5-bisphosphate (PI(4,5)P2), a critical phospholipid that regulates various cellular processes. The two types of PIP5K, Type I and Type II, were initially believed to have similar functions. However, further research revealed that Type II enzymes are actually phosphatidylinositol 5-phosphate 4-kinases. Unconventional Secretion of FGF2:
Fibroblast growth factor 2 (FGF2) is a crucial signaling molecule involved in various cellular processes, including cell proliferation and differentiation. The unconventional secretion of FGF2 refers to its release from cells without the involvement of the classical endoplasmic reticulum-Golgi pathway.
